The Musk Dynasty: How Elon Became the World's Richest Man
Elon Musk didn't become the richest person in the world by sitting on a money tree. No, sir. He's the founder and CEO of SpaceX, a space exploration company that's revolutionizing the way we think about space travel. He's also the CEO of Tesla, the electric vehicle and clean energy company that's giving gas-guzzlers the middle finger.
But how did he make his fortune? Well, it all started with PayPal. Yep, that's right. Elon co-founded PayPal back in the early 2000s and cashed out in 2002 when eBay bought the company for $1.5 billion. From there, he poured his money into SpaceX and Tesla, turning his vision into reality and making himself the richest person in the world.
The Billionaire's Club: The Top 5 Richest People in the World
Elon Musk might be the richest person in the world, but he's not the only billionaire swimming in cash. Let's take a look at the top 5 richest people in the world, as of 2021.
#1 Elon Musk - $200+ billion
We already talked about this guy, but it's worth mentioning again. Elon's net worth has been fluctuating like a rollercoaster, but he's consistently held the title of the world's richest person since 2021.
#2 Jeff Bezos - $170+ billion
The former Amazon CEO and current space tourist is the second richest person in the world. Jeff founded Amazon back in 1994 and turned it into the e-commerce giant it is today. He also owns Blue Origin, a space exploration company that's giving SpaceX a run for its money.
#3 Bernard Arnault & family - $150+ billion
Meet the richest person in Europe and the owner of the world's largest luxury goods company, LVMH. Bernard Arnault has been the CEO of LVMH since 1989 and has turned it into a fashion and luxury goods empire that includes brands like Louis Vuitton, Dior, and Givenchy.
#4 Mark Zuckerberg - $90+ billion
The co-founder and CEO of Facebook (now Meta) is the fourth richest person in the world. Mark created Facebook in 2004 while he was a student at Harvard University and turned it into a social media behemoth with over 2.8 billion monthly active users.
#5 Bill Gates - $80+ billion
The co-founder of Microsoft and a philanthropist extraordinaire, Bill Gates is the fifth richest person in the world. Bill stepped down as CEO of Microsoft in 2000 and has since focused on his philanthropic endeavors through the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ation.

The Dark Side of Billionairedom: Criticisms and Controversies
While billionaires have a lot to offer the world, they're not without their criticisms and controversies. Some people argue that billionaires have too much power and influence, using their wealth to shape politics and society in their favor. Others point to the growing wealth gap, with billionaires becoming richer while the rest of the world struggles with income inequality and poverty.
There are also criticisms of how some billionaires made their money in the first place. Some have been accused of exploiting workers, dodging taxes, and engaging in unethical business practices. And let's not forget about the environmental impact of some billionaire-owned industries, like fossil fuels and deforestation.
